Transaction f19c5bfc3ba4f675de51f6bb5a589ca5f55d90e68e19dbce9a740efcb43ca897

6 Input
1 Outputs
  • f19c5bfc3ba4f675de51f6bb5a589ca5f55d90e68e19dbce9a740efcb43ca897:0
  • value  14555705
    address  1LhbTa9B3G9D3byEZDf7irY8snMoS6f6yW